BREAKING: Lagos State Govt Suspends Opening Of Mosques, Churches by Sasjnrblog001: 6:20pm On Jun 16, 2020
The Lagos State Government on Tuesday announced the suspension of the earlier scheduled opening of churches and mosques in the state.



The Lagos State governor, made the announcement while addressing journalists at the State House, Marina.




The opening, which was earlier slated to start on June 19 for mosques and June 21 for churches, has now been suspended.
